Do Nicaraguan Citizens Need a Visa for Paraguay?

Nicaraguan citizens do not need a visa when traveling to Paraguay. Officially, Nicaraguan nationals entering Paraguay can do so with a valid passport.

Passport Validity Requirements for Traveling to Paraguay

To enter Paraguay, Nicaraguan citizens must have a passport that is valid for at least **six months**. This is very important to avoid any issues during travel. Your passport's validity must exceed six months from the date of travel to ensure a smooth and valid entry during your stay in Paraguay.

Duration of Stay and Extension Procedures

Nicaraguan citizens can stay in Paraguay without a visa for up to **90 days** upon arrival. However, it is important to plan your accommodation or travel arrangements well during this period. If you are considering staying in Paraguay for a longer duration, you may need to extend this period. To extend your stay while in Paraguay, you must apply to the local immigration office.

The documents typically required for extending your stay include:

  • Passport
  • Valid identification
  • Reason for extending your stay (e.g., work or family reasons)

Customs Rules and Border Control

Upon entering Paraguay, you must comply with customs rules. Some documents and information you need to have at border control include: - Passport - Travel health insurance (recommended) - Address information for your stay in Paraguay - If applicable, your return ticket

At customs, you are allowed to bring personal belongings along with a certain amount of money or valuables. However, if you plan to enter with a large amount of cash or valuables, you may need to declare them.

Security and Health Situation in Paraguay

While Paraguay is generally considered a safe travel destination, you may need to exercise caution in certain areas. It is important to continuously monitor the security situation. When traveling to Paraguay, you should pay attention to the following recommendations for personal safety: - Be mindful of your valuables in crowded areas. - Avoid walking alone late at night. - Pay attention to local security warnings and advice.

In terms of health, Nicaraguan citizens wishing to enter Paraguay must have received the yellow fever vaccine and present an international vaccination certificate. This is especially mandatory for those coming from yellow fever risk areas.

Transportation and Local Communication

Transportation in Paraguay offers a variety of options. The country has bus, taxi, and car rental services available. Asuncion, the capital of Paraguay, is the most developed city in terms of transportation. You can easily explore the city using public transport here.

For local communication, it may be a good idea to obtain international SIM cards or a local SIM card for mobile phones in Paraguay. Local lines generally offer competitive prices.
